Skip to content
This repository was archived by the owner on Sep 30, 2024. It is now read-only.

chore: Remove unused TTL in object.Storage config#63947

Merged
varungandhi-src merged 1 commit into
mainfrom
vg/remove-ttl
Jul 22, 2024
Merged

chore: Remove unused TTL in object.Storage config#63947
varungandhi-src merged 1 commit into
mainfrom
vg/remove-ttl

Conversation

@varungandhi-src

Copy link
Copy Markdown
Contributor

In this PR (https://github.com/sourcegraph/sourcegraph/pull/45042), it is noted that:

Removed lifecycle configuration from uploadstore, instead relying just on our own
builtin background worker to expire objects.

As a result, the TTL field on the GCS Client was not used anywhere. So this patch
removes the TTL field.

Test plan

Covered by existing tests

@cla-bot cla-bot Bot added the cla-signed label Jul 19, 2024
@varungandhi-src varungandhi-src requested a review from eseliger July 19, 2024 11:18
@github-actions github-actions Bot added team/graph Graph Team (previously Code Intel/Language Tools/Language Platform) team/product-platform labels Jul 19, 2024
Base automatically changed from vg/rename to main July 22, 2024 00:57
@varungandhi-src varungandhi-src enabled auto-merge (squash) July 22, 2024 00:59
@varungandhi-src varungandhi-src merged commit fb51358 into main Jul 22, 2024
@varungandhi-src varungandhi-src deleted the vg/remove-ttl branch July 22, 2024 02:58
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.

Labels

cla-signed team/graph Graph Team (previously Code Intel/Language Tools/Language Platform) team/product-platform

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ants